Replacing a Side Turn Signal Bulb
CLIPS
1.
If you are changing the bulb on
the driver's side, start the engine,
turn the steering wheel all the way
to the left, and turn off the engine.
If you are changing the bulb on
the passenger's side, turn the
steering wheel to the right.
2.
Use a flat-tipped screwdriver to
remove the three holding clips
from the inner fender.

3.
Pull the inner fender cover away
from the fender.
4.
Remove the socket from the turn
signal assembly by turning it one-
quarter turn counterclockwise.

5.
Pull the burned out bulb straight
out of its socket.
Push the new bulb straight into
the socket until it bottoms.
6.
Insert the socket back into the
turn signal assembly. Turn it
clockwise to lock it in place.
7.
Turn on the lights to make sure
the new bulb is working.
8.
Put the inner fender cover in place.
Install the three holding clips.
Lock each clip in place by pushing
on the center.
